1 理解启动Spring原理
单例:spring启动 -> 解析 xml -> 创建bean对象 ->bean保存到容器中 -> 随着容器的销毁而销毁
多例:spring启动 -> 解析xml -> 把解析出来的bean对象记录下来 -> 调用的时候创建bean对象
2 什么是spring
spring是一个容器 用来装bean的容器 管理bean的生命周期
3 什么是ioc
ioc就是控制反转,将管理bean的控制权 由程序员 转交给了 spring,由spring来管理对象
4 依赖注入的方式
spring通过set的方式进行属性依赖注入给对象
其中自动装配有两种模式
一种是autowire="byType" 是根据bean class与对象属性中的数据类型 进行寻找
一种是autowire="byName"是根据bean id 与对象属性名称 尽心匹配寻找
5 单例模式与多例模式
单例模式 在创建 bean的时候就初始化 无参构造
多例模式 在调用 bean的时候才初始化 无参构造
6 懒加载
开启懒加载的bean 只能在调用的时候 初始化 无参构造
spring小总结(说错的麻烦提醒)
最新推荐文章于 2024-10-17 12:41:10 发布